Jailed former secretary of Station 42 ordered to pay restitution

By Vanessa Fultz, Democrat Reporter

A former secretary of Volunteer Fire Station 42 in O'Brien has been ordered to pay $5,287.89 in restitution to Suwannee County Fire/Rescue.

Susan Nazworth, a.k.a. Susan Mahn Hayes or Susan Osteen, 37, was ordered to pay restitution on Dec. 17. Nazworth was sentenced to 18 months in prison in October on charges of grand theft and fraud. Nazworth took more than $5,000 in cash from the station between November 2004 and June 2007.

Nazworth was arrested in January on charges of grand theft III and fraudulent practices. Court records show that Nazworth took at least $5,000 but not more than $10,000 with "the intent to either temporarily or permanently deprive O'Brien Volunteer Fire Department of a right to the property or a benefit."

Upon completion of her prison term, Nazworth will serve 42 months of probation with one year of community control.
